Instance Method Details

#set(file_path) ⇒ Object

set the file location in the Choose file dialog

# File 'lib/vapir-ie/input_elements.rb', line 104

def set(file_path)
  assert_exists do
    # it would be nice to do a click_no_wait and then enter the select file dialog information
    # in the same thread, but that won't work here, because #click_no_wait runs in a javascript 
    # setTimeout, and javascript calling to a file input's .click() method doesn't work. it appears 
    # to work until you submit the form, at which point it says access is denied. so, the click has 
    # to be done via WIN32OLE, but it doesn't return until the file field is set, so we need two
    # ruby processes (since WIN32OLE blocking blocks all ruby threads).
    # since locating this element is a much more complicated task than locating the enabled_popup
    # of this browser, this process will handle the former, and we'll spawn another to do the
    # latter.
    require 'win32/process'
    Vapir.require_winwindow
    rubyw_exe= File.join(Config::CONFIG['bindir'], 'rubyw')
    error_file_name=File.expand_path(File.join(File.dirname(__FILE__), 'scripts', 'select_file_error_status.marshal_dump'))
    select_file_script=File.expand_path(File.join(File.dirname(__FILE__), 'scripts', 'select_file.rb'))
    command_line=rubyw_exe+[select_file_script, browser.hwnd.to_s, file_path, error_file_name].map{|arg| " \"#{arg.gsub("/", "\\")}\""}.join('')
     # TODO/FIX: the above method of escaping seems to have issues with trailing slashes. 
    select_file_process=::Process.create('command_line' => command_line)
    
    click
    
    if ::Waiter.try_for(2, :exception => nil) { File.exists?(error_file_name) } # wait around a moment for the script to finish writing - #click returns before that script exits 
      marshaled_error=File.read(error_file_name)
      error=Marshal.load(marshaled_error)
      error[:backtrace]+= caller(0)
      File.delete(error_file_name)
      raise error[:class], error[:message], error[:backtrace]
    end
    return file_path
    # TODO/FIX: figure out what events ought to be fired here - onchange, maybe others
  end
end
